Here is the EO outlining the changes in tariff policy for the next 90 days with China. As policies change very quickly, be sure to get advice from specialists that actually understand what has been happening, and not from soneone who suddenly decided they are an “expert.”
Do note that de minimis has been adjusted, with a lower rate. As the document reads in part: “(a) decrease the ad valorem rate of duty set forth in section 2(c)(i) of Executive Order 14256 of April 2, 2025 (Further Amendment to Duties Addressing the Synthetic Opioid Supply Chain in the People’s Republic of China as Applied to Low-Value Imports), as modified by Executive Order 14259 and Executive Order 14266, from 120 percent to 54 percent; (b) retain in effect the per postal item containing goods duty of 100 dollars in section 2(c)(ii) …”
